How to fill out medicare shared savings program

How to fill out Medicare Shared Savings Program:
01
Begin by reviewing the eligibility requirements for the Medicare Shared Savings Program. Make sure you meet the criteria set by the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S).
02
Determine whether you want to participate as an accountable care organization (ACO) or if you would prefer to join an existing ACO. If you choose to form a new ACO, gather the necessary information and documentation to establish it.
03
Familiarize yourself with the application process for the Medicare Shared Savings Program. Visit the CMS website or contact their designated representative to obtain the necessary forms and instructions.
04
Complete the required application forms accurately and thoroughly. Provide all the requested information, including your organization's details, leadership structure, and any supporting documentation that may be required.
05
Ensure that you have carefully reviewed and understood the program's legal and financial requirements. It is important to have a solid understanding of the financial and legal implications before moving forward.
06
Submit your completed application within the designated timeframe specified by CMS. Pay close attention to any deadlines and ensure that all required documents are included with your submission.
07
Once your application has been reviewed and accepted, you will receive notification from CMS. This will include details on your participation status and any additional steps or requirements to be completed.
Who needs Medicare Shared Savings Program?
01
Healthcare providers aiming to improve the quality of care while reducing costs for Medicare beneficiaries can benefit from the Medicare Shared Savings Program. This program provides an avenue for providers to collaborate and coordinate care more effectively.
02
Accountable care organizations (ACOs) can greatly benefit from the Medicare Shared Savings Program. ACOs are groups of healthcare providers who work together to deliver coordinated care to Medicare beneficiaries. Participating in the program allows ACOs to share in any savings achieved based on their ability to meet certain quality and performance measures.
03
Medicare beneficiaries can also indirectly benefit from the Medicare Shared Savings Program. By participating in an ACO, their healthcare providers are more likely to focus on providing high-quality care and improving patient outcomes, which can result in better healthcare experiences for the beneficiaries.
In summary, the Medicare Shared Savings Program offers healthcare providers and accountable care organizations the opportunity to enhance the quality of care while reducing costs for Medicare beneficiaries. By following the application process and meeting the eligibility requirements, providers can successfully participate in the program and contribute to improved healthcare outcomes.

What is medicare shared savings program?
Medicare Shared Savings Program aims to improve the quality of care for Medicare Fee-For-Service beneficiaries while reducing unnecessary costs.
Who is required to file medicare shared savings program?
Accountable Care Organizations (ACOs) participating in the Medicare Shared Savings Program are required to file.
How to fill out medicare shared savings program?
To fill out the Medicare Shared Savings Program, ACOs must report quality measures, financial information, and other data related to the care provided to beneficiaries.
What is the purpose of medicare shared savings program?
The purpose of the Medicare Shared Savings Program is to promote accountability for the care of Medicare beneficiaries, improve population health, and reduce unnecessary costs.
What information must be reported on medicare shared savings program?
ACOs participating in the Medicare Shared Savings Program must report quality measures, financial and utilization data, and other information related to the care provided to beneficiaries.
